Skip to content

Commit 367d593

Browse files
authored
Merge pull request #5151 from nextcloud/backport/5126/stable27
[stable27] preserve websocket provider queue during reconnects
2 parents 0d6a427 + 4a79e63 commit 367d593

19 files changed

+168
-41
lines changed

β€Žcypress/e2e/api/SyncServiceProvider.spec.jsβ€Ž

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-60,6 +60,7 @@ describe('Sync service provider', function() {
6060
* @param {object} ydoc Yjs document
6161
*/
6262
function createProvider(ydoc) {
63+
const queue = []
6364
const syncService = new SyncService({
6465
serialize: () => 'Serialized',
6566
getDocumentState: () => null,
@@ -70,6 +71,7 @@ describe('Sync service provider', function() {
7071
syncService,
7172
fileId,
7273
initialSession: null,
74+
queue,
7375
disableBc: true,
7476
})
7577
}

β€Žjs/editor.jsβ€Ž

Lines changed: 2 additions & 2 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

β€Žjs/editor.js.mapβ€Ž

Lines changed: 1 addition &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

β€Žjs/files-modal.jsβ€Ž

Lines changed: 2 additions & 2 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

β€Žjs/files-modal.js.mapβ€Ž

Lines changed: 1 addition &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

β€Žjs/text-editors.jsβ€Ž

Lines changed: 2 additions & 2 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

β€Žjs/text-editors.js.mapβ€Ž

Lines changed: 1 addition &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

β€Žjs/text-files.jsβ€Ž

Lines changed: 2 additions & 2 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

β€Žjs/text-files.js.mapβ€Ž

Lines changed: 1 addition &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

β€Žjs/text-public.jsβ€Ž

Lines changed: 2 additions & 2 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

0 commit comments

Comments
Β (0)